Aerosoft BenBaron 286 Posted April 15, 2022 Aerosoft Share Posted April 15, 2022 vor 2 Stunden schrieb Mathijs Kok: It uses the standard display engine from the sim so I do not predict any problem. Hi guys, to elaborate a bit further on that: unfortunatley I don't think the UI will be compatible with VR right now, due to the currently limited options for native UI interactions from external programs or WASM. With that said, as soon as there is a possiblity to employ a fully dynamic UI for those, the plan is to refactor the application into a WASM, so it can potentially also be deployed onto X-BOX. 1 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
